Output 957950954b2d8bfbf9be59a34c7b249cb12695ddcdea5dd23d842d75da7e855e:1

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ae7268ec5706bde08a2c6a11ea2a5e3d03f0a692 OP_EQUAL
address
3HbQZFwaiMCxjPVNyHHqMdfnNUZG9wsA96
transaction
957950954b2d8bfbf9be59a34c7b249cb12695ddcdea5dd23d842d75da7e855e
spent
true